About Kotra Kagla Village

Kotra Kagla is a mid sized village in Manohar Thana tehsil, in the district of Jhalawar, Rajasthan.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 728, made up of 388 males and 340 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 876 females per 1000 males. The village covers 887.57 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 326037,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Kotra Kagla

The census records public bus service for Kotra Kagla as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
